Trends in Fashionable Sofas
1. Sustainable Materials
Recently, sustainability has become a significant trend in the furniture industry. Customers are more knowledgeable about their ecological footprint, and this awareness has actually caused an increase in the popularity of sofas made from environmentally friendly products. Brand names are progressively utilizing recycled materials, sustainably sourced wood, and non-toxic finishes.
2. Modular Designs
Modular sofas are becoming a favorite amongst house owners, using adaptability and adaptability. These sofas can be rearranged to fit various spaces or occasions, allowing for creativity in the design. They are specifically helpful in smaller houses where area optimization is vital.
3. Vibrant Colors and Patterns
Gone are the days when neutral tones controlled the sofa scene. Today's trendy sofas show off bold colors and attractive patterns. Jewel tones, such as emerald green and sapphire blue, in addition to lively patterns, are trending. This shift permits house owners to reveal their character and style through their furniture.
4. Classic and Retro Styles
The appeal of vintage and retro designs stays ageless. Sofas influenced by mid-century contemporary or art deco styles are picking up. These pieces add character to modern areas, using a sentimental touch without compromising on modern-day convenience.
5. Minimalist Aesthetics
While strong designs have their place, minimalist sofas are also trending. Clean lines, understated style, and practical kinds identify this design. These sofas frequently mix effortlessly into different decoration styles, attracting those who prefer simpleness.
The Anatomy of a Fashionable Sofa
Picking a stylish sofa requires an understanding of its elements. The following table describes the key functions to think about:
| Feature | Description | Importance |
|---|---|---|
| Frame Material | Wood, metal, or composite products | Figures out resilience and support |
| Upholstery Fabric | Leather, linen, polyester, or cotton | Impacts look, comfort, and maintenance |
| Cushion Fill | Foam, down, or a mix | Impacts softness and assistance |
| Design Style | Modern, traditional, retro, minimalist | Matches the general design |
| Color/Pattern | Solid colors, prints, textures | Deals flexibility in design styles |
Practical Tips for Choosing a Fashionable Sofa
- Evaluate the Space: Measure the available location to make sure the sofa fits without overwhelming the room.
- Specify Your Style: Identify your decor design-- whether it's modern, rustic, or eclectic. This will guide your option.
- Test for Comfort: Comfort is as essential as visual appeals. Test different sofas for convenience levels before making a decision.
- Color Coordination: Choose a color or pattern that complements other components in the room such as wall colors, rugs, and art work.
- Resilience: Invest in high-quality products that stand up to wear and tear, particularly if you have family pets or children.
FAQs About Fashionable Sofas
Q1: What is the finest product for a sofa?
A1: The best material depends upon personal choice and way of life. Leather offers toughness and simple upkeep, while material sofas provide convenience and a softer feel. For families, consider materials that are durable and simple to tidy, such as microfiber or performance fabrics.
Q2: How do I maintain my sofa?
A2: Regular vacuuming to get rid of dirt and particles is essential. For material sofas, spot cleaning with proper cleaners can assist address discolorations. Leather sofas require routine conditioning to preserve their luster and avoid cracking. Constantly inspect the manufacturer's care standards for specific guidelines.
Q3: Are modular sofas worth it?
A3: Yes, modular sofas are worth the financial investment if you focus on versatility. They can be reorganized, enabling numerous configurations that can adjust to changing needs. This makes them perfect for entertaining visitors or adapting to various room designs.
Q4: How can I make a small area work with a sofa?
A4: Choose a compact or sectional sofa that fits the measurements of your space. Go with lighter colors to create an impression of space, and think about multifunctional pieces, like sofas with storage choices.
Q5: What patterns should I search for in 2024?
A5: Look out for increased incorporation of smart innovation in sofas, such as built-in charging ports, in addition to the continued popularity of strong colors and sustainable materials. Furthermore, adaptable styles that accommodate remote working environments might gain traction.
